Scottish Oriental Smaller Trust (The) Scaled Net Operating Assets Calculation

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) is calculated as the difference between operating assets and operating liabilities, scaled by lagged total assets.

Scottish Oriental Smaller Trust (The)'s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) for the fiscal year that ended in Aug. 2025 is calculated as

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A)(A: Aug. 2025 )
=(Operating Assets (A: Aug. 2025 )-Operating Liabilities (A: Aug. 2025 ))/Total Assets (A: Aug. 2024 )
=(410.561-5.493)/450.564
=0.90

where

Operating Assets(A: Aug. 2025 )
=Total Assets - Balance Sheet Cash And Cash Equivalents
=417.211 - 6.65
=410.561

Operating Liabilities(A: Aug. 2025 )
=Total Liabilities -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ation -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ation
=35.344 - 29.851 - 0
=5.493

Scottish Oriental Smaller Trust (The) Business Description

Address 28 Walker Street, Edinburgh, GBR, EH3 7HR
Scottish Oriental Smaller Companies Trust (The) PLC is a investment trusts in the Asian equity category with a specialist focus on smaller companies. The objective of the Company is to achieve long-term capital growth by carefully selecting quality companies with franchises at reasonable valuations.
